This commit is contained in:
gsinghpal
2026-05-18 22:33:23 -04:00
parent 25f568f225
commit 091f98e1f9
76 changed files with 4521 additions and 220 deletions

View File

@@ -0,0 +1,120 @@
<?xml version="1.0" encoding="UTF-8"?>
<!--
Copyright 2026 Nexa Systems Inc.
License OPL-1 (Odoo Proprietary License v1.0)
Part of the Fusion Plating product family.
Seeds the 12 carrier records the plating shop uses that are NOT
already provided by Odoo / fusion_shipping. All start with
delivery_type='fixed'; Phase D will flip Purolator (and any others
we add integrations for) to their real delivery_type.
noupdate=1 — these records are upserted once on install. Hand-edits
on the carrier records (e.g. renaming "FedEx" to "FedEx Express")
are preserved across module upgrades.
-->
<odoo noupdate="1">
<record id="delivery_carrier_ups" model="delivery.carrier">
<field name="name">UPS</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">20</field>
</record>
<record id="delivery_carrier_fedex" model="delivery.carrier">
<field name="name">FedEx</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">21</field>
</record>
<record id="delivery_carrier_usps" model="delivery.carrier">
<field name="name">USPS</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">22</field>
</record>
<record id="delivery_carrier_dhl" model="delivery.carrier">
<field name="name">DHL</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">23</field>
</record>
<record id="delivery_carrier_purolator" model="delivery.carrier">
<field name="name">Purolator</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">24</field>
</record>
<record id="delivery_carrier_cct" model="delivery.carrier">
<field name="name">CCT</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">25</field>
</record>
<record id="delivery_carrier_canpar" model="delivery.carrier">
<field name="name">Canpar Express</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">26</field>
</record>
<record id="delivery_carrier_gls_canada" model="delivery.carrier">
<field name="name">GLS Canada</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">27</field>
</record>
<record id="delivery_carrier_loomis" model="delivery.carrier">
<field name="name">Loomis Express</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">28</field>
</record>
<record id="delivery_carrier_day_ross" model="delivery.carrier">
<field name="name">Day &amp; Ross</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">29</field>
</record>
<record id="delivery_carrier_dicom" model="delivery.carrier">
<field name="name">Dicom Transportation</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">30</field>
</record>
<record id="delivery_carrier_customer_dropoff" model="delivery.carrier">
<field name="name">Customer Drop-off</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">31</field>
</record>
<record id="delivery_carrier_local_delivery" model="delivery.carrier">
<field name="name">Local Delivery</field>
<field name="delivery_type">fixed</field>
<field name="product_id" ref="delivery.product_product_delivery"/>
<field name="fixed_price">0</field>
<field name="sequence">32</field>
</record>
</odoo>